Day 1 – Marahau to Anchorage (Approx. 4 hours/12.4km)

After pick up from your Nelson accommodation and introduction to your guide, you will be transported to Marahau where your walk will begin.  Today you will pass through regenerating forest and walk alongside beautiful golden sand beaches. Linger at Apple Tree Bay, before gaining some altitude to enjoy great views over all of Tasman Bay.

Day 2 – Anchorage to Awaroa Inlet (approx. 7.5 hours - 21.9kms or 6.5hrs - 18.8kms with available tidal shortcut at Torrent Bay)

Begin walking along the wonderful beach at Anchorage, pass civilised Torrent Bay before heading up and over to the iconic Falls River swing bridge and further to Bark Bay. From this lovely bay the track heads up a large ascent before making your way back to sea level at Tonga Quarry then Onetahuti Beach. A lovely walk along crescent shaped Onetahuti Beach follows and then the last saddle sees you over to wonderful Awaroa Lodge. Day 3 - Awaroa Inlet to Totaranui (approx. 3 hours - 8.1kms Plus additional loop track walk of 1 hour (optional))

After breakfast, your walk begins with the wide tidal crossing about 20 minutes from Awaroa Lodge. Then it is into some wonderful podocarp forest before bursting out on the golden sand of Waiharakeke Bay and Goat Bay before the ascent over to the popular camping spot of Totaranui. At Totaranui enjoy one of our favourite short walks (the Pukatea loop track) before meeting our land shuttle to the highly-rated Ratanui Lodge. Day 4 - Wainui to Totaranui (approx. 5 hours 15.5kms)

After breakfast, a short shuttle to Wainui Carpark takes you to the last section of your walk. From Wainui you are on the less travelled section of the track. The views of Wainui Inlet as you climb up into the native forest are stunning. The route today takes you up and over to Whariwharangi, then you’ll have the option of walking the Separation Point Loop track (an extra hour) before heading on to Mutton Cove and Anapai Beach before arriving at Totaranui. Once at Totaranui the AquaTaxi will pick you up and return you past all those golden sand beaches to Marahau. Our land transport to Nelson departs conveniently from the AquaTaxi base dropping you in Nelson around 6pm.

Please note - Part of the track is tidal and the tides (and accommodation availability) indicate the direction of the walk and this may change from the itinerary above, according to the tide timetable of the dates you choose for your walk.
